Find 3 values that satisfy the inequality 4x - 3 < 25

Answer:See explanation

Step-by-step explanation:

The values that can be used to satisfy the inequality 4x - 3 < 25 will be calculated thus. We simply have to get the value of x and this will be:

4x - 3 < 25

4x < 25 + 3

4x < 28

x < 28/4

x < 7.

Therefore, the values that must satisfy the equation must be less than 7 such as 1, 2, 3, 4, 5 and 6.
